Leno: Clarify Jackson trial gag order
http://www.cnn.com/2005/LAW/03/03/jackson.trial.leno/index.html

Late night talk show host Jay Leno, subpoenaed to appear as a defense witness in the Michael Jackson child molestation trial, has asked that a judge clarify the gag order in the case so he can continue to mention the trial in his nightly monologue.

According to court papers released Wednesday by the Santa Barbara County Superior Court, "The Tonight Show" host was subpoenaed February 17 to appear as a witness in the trial and filed a motion for clarification on the gag order February 18.

In the motion, attorneys for Leno asked that the gag order not be applied to the comic. But if it must be, they asked that it be amended to only prevent him from speaking about firsthand information he has in the case.
